Compartilhar via


CardGetNextTuple

Windows Mobile Not SupportedWindows Embedded CE Supported

9/8/2008

Essa função recupera o próximo tupla do tipo especificado para a função e Soquete especificado.

Syntax

STATUS CardGetNextTuple(
  PCARD_TUPLE_PARMS pGetTupleParms 
);

Parameters

Return Value

CERR_SUCCESS indica sucesso. Um do seguinte valores indica falha:

  • CERR_BAD_ARGS
    Indica que o ponteiro especificado para pGetTupleParms não é válido.
  • CERR_BAD_SOCKET
    Indica que o hSocket identificador Soquete in CARD_TUPLE_PARMS não é válido ou que nenhuma placa PC é inserida na Soquete.
  • CERR_NO_MORE_ITEMS
    Indica que a fim de cartão informações estrutura (CIS) foi alcançado ou que a tupla solicitada não foi encontrada.
  • CERR_OUT_OF_RESOURCE
    Indica que os serviços cartão é Não é possível configurar uma janela memória para ler o CIS.
  • CERR_READ_FAILURE
    Indica que nenhuma placa PC é inserida ou se o cartão PC está ilegível.

Remarks

Essa função segue o encadear tupla CIS, conforme especificado pelo uLinkOffset, uCISOffset, e fFlags Os membros do CARD_TUPLE_PARMS. Esses membros foram definidos por um chamar anterior para o CardGetFirstTuple função ou essa função.

Para obter dados tupla, use CardGetTupleData.

O driver retém os valores retornados na uLinkOffset, uCISOffset, e fFlags Os membros do CARD_TUPLE_PARMS Para que chamadas subseqüentes para esta função ou CardGetTupleData pode seguir o encadear tupla. O driver não acessar a uTupleCode e uTupleLinkOs membros a menos que o valor de retorno CERR_SUCCESS.

O CARD_TUPLE_PARMS e CARD_DATA_PARMS estruturas são organizadas para que seus correspondente membros são alinhados. Com cuidado, drivers podem usar uma reserva única em todas as chamadas para as funções tupla serviços cartão.

Requirements

Header cardsv2.h
Library Pcc_serv.dll
Windows Embedded CE Windows CE 1.0 and later

See Also

Reference

CARD_DATA_PARMS
CARD_TUPLE_PARMS
CardGetFirstTuple
CardGetTupleData